Output d8faf5f3ddbb85ab54defc18628abc0fd26c57510fe93d3f4d008b3b7b7d3f0f:5

value
108604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38ff8c7d0abf203110f85a77b34992d997b3ed4 OP_EQUAL
address
3PtrbVdmkCbKST5JhNoB1oR5VUQDGJepJn
transaction
d8faf5f3ddbb85ab54defc18628abc0fd26c57510fe93d3f4d008b3b7b7d3f0f
confirmations
224235
spent
true